- Timestamp:
- Sep 17, 2001, 4:27:56 AM (24 years ago)
- Location:
- trunk/src/win32k/kKrnlLib
- Files:
-
- 4 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/win32k/kKrnlLib/Makefile
r6739 r6740 1 # $Id: Makefile,v 1. 7 2001-09-17 01:47:35bird Exp $1 # $Id: Makefile,v 1.8 2001-09-17 02:27:54 bird Exp $ 2 2 3 3 # … … 154 154 $(WIN32KOBJ)\d16globl.obj \ 155 155 $(WIN32KOBJ)\calltaba.obj \ 156 $(WIN32KOBJ)\krnlInit.obj \156 $(WIN32KOBJ)\krnlInit.obj_tst. \ 157 157 $(WIN32KOBJ)\krnlLockedWrite.obj \ 158 158 $(WIN32KOBJ)\krnlOverloading.obj \ … … 247 247 # List of object files in the converted devhelp library. 248 248 DHLPOBJS = +$(WIN32KOBJ)\dhcall5b.obj +$(WIN32KOBJ)\dhcal11a.obj \ 249 +$(WIN32KOBJ)\dhcal11g.obj +$(WIN32KOBJ)\dhret.obj 249 +$(WIN32KOBJ)\dhcal11g.obj +$(WIN32KOBJ)\dhret.obj \ 250 +$(WIN32KOBJ)\dhcall2e.obj 250 251 251 252 # Make corrected devhelp library with only the required object files. -
trunk/src/win32k/kKrnlLib/include/kKLInitHlp.h
r6696 r6740 1 /* $Id: kKLInitHlp.h,v 1. 2 2001-09-11 01:27:28bird Exp $1 /* $Id: kKLInitHlp.h,v 1.3 2001-09-17 02:27:55 bird Exp $ 2 2 * 3 3 * Definition of the R0 initiation helper IOCtl interface. … … 17 17 * Ring 0 init helper IOCtl 18 18 */ 19 #define KKL_DEVICE_NAME " kKrnlHlp"19 #define KKL_DEVICE_NAME "\\dev\\kKrnlHlp" 20 20 #define KKL_IOCTL_CAT 0xC1 21 21 #define KKL_IOCTL_RING0INIT 0x42 -
trunk/src/win32k/kKrnlLib/testcase/DH.asm
r6736 r6740 1 ; $Id: DH.asm,v 1. 1 2001-09-17 01:41:12bird Exp $1 ; $Id: DH.asm,v 1.2 2001-09-17 02:27:55 bird Exp $ 2 2 ; 3 3 ; Device Helper Router. … … 110 110 111 111 dhr6: 112 cmp dl, DevHlp_VerifyAccess 113 jne dhr7 114 call dh_VerifyAccess 115 jmp dhr_ret 116 117 dhr7: 112 118 113 119 dhr_notimplemented: … … 501 507 502 508 509 ;; 510 ; VerifyAccess stub. 511 ; @returns NO_ERROR. (0) 512 ; @param ignored. 513 ; @uses eax 514 ; @status stub. 515 ; @author knut st. osmundsen (knut.stange.osmundsen@pmsc.no) 516 dh_VerifyAccess PROC NEAR 517 xor eax, eax 518 clc 519 ret 520 dh_VerifyAccess ENDP 521 522 503 523 CODE16 ENDS 504 524 -
trunk/src/win32k/kKrnlLib/testcase/DosA.asm
r6736 r6740 1 ; $Id: DosA.asm,v 1. 1 2001-09-17 01:41:12bird Exp $1 ; $Id: DosA.asm,v 1.2 2001-09-17 02:27:56 bird Exp $ 2 2 ; 3 3 ; 16-bits Dos calls overloader … … 14 14 ; 15 15 include devsegdf.inc 16 INCL_DOSERRORS EQU 1 16 17 include os2.inc 17 18 include devsym.inc … … 105 106 cmp eax, 'lHln' ; 'nlHl' 106 107 jnz do_notkKrnlHlp 107 mov eax, ds:[ebx+ 8]108 mov eax, ds:[ebx+0ch] 108 109 cmp ax, 'p' ; 'p\0' 109 110 jnz do_notkKrnlHlp … … 141 142 pop bx 142 143 pop ds 144 mov ax, ERROR_FILE_NOT_FOUND 143 145 leave 144 146 ret 01ah
Note:
See TracChangeset
for help on using the changeset viewer.